Output 8659d4a94dde9ed349cf7e4957df3eb7b6ddd4568c0d59cae95b64a0f0e5d092:1

value
11094700
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c8a5a91128cb7b874980b4607f39a20d698cf8ff OP_EQUAL
address
3KywXCQZP1Y5cfvRdpD6dPDDHx51Sr29Pq
transaction
8659d4a94dde9ed349cf7e4957df3eb7b6ddd4568c0d59cae95b64a0f0e5d092
spent
true